Ticket: Roof-terrace door, Level 9, Ostren Building — latch jams repeatedly when pushed from inside, worse in cold weather. Night shift reported two staff briefly stuck on 12 March. Please inspect hinge alignment and strike plate. Until fixed, use the secondary stairwell door, which requires the after-hours access code.

staff pass of kawip-hawef = bdg-QLP-2

## Release checklist — FareSplit pricing experiment

- [ ] Confirm the FareSplit experiment flags match the approved variant list (heads up, new folks: the control bucket must stay at 50%). Double-check the pricing table snapshot was frozen before cutover, then paste the build token shown below into the release thread.

build token for tawip-yageg: htk9_92ac43d42

ALERT: ChipGate reader heartbeat missed. Fires when a StrideSync timing mat at any Harlow Bay Marathon checkpoint fails to report for 90 seconds. Runners crossing a dead mat lose splits permanently — no retro fix. First: check mat power and the trackside relay box. Second: fail over to the backup reader via the ops console. Don't silence this alert without confirming failover. Full triage steps are on the internal wiki page below.

wiki page, faduf-tagaf: https://superset.halixdata.example/build

## Releases

Hey support folks — quick notes on ProfileMesh shard releases. Each release re-balances user-profile shards gradually, so don't panic if a lookup lands on a stale shard for a few minutes post-deploy; it self-heals. Release bundles are published twice a month and are always signed. If a customer asks you to verify a bundle they downloaded, walk them through the checksum step using the public signing key below.

deploy key for kawif-bageg: bky19_YQNdHDgpaLxUNwPoHm9